> On Mon, Nov 30, 2020 at 05:52:56PM +0100, Greg Kurz wrote: > > The machine tells the IC backend the number of vCPU ids it will be > > exposed to, in order to: > > - fill the "ibm,interrupt-server-ranges" property in the DT (XICS) > > - size the VP block used by the in-kernel chip (XICS-on-XIVE, XIVE) > > > > The current "nr_servers" and "spapr_max_server_number" naming can > > mislead people info thinking it is about a quantity of CPUs. Make > > it clear this is all about vCPU ids. > > > > Signed-off-by: Greg Kurz <gr...@kaod.org> > > I know it seems very finicky, but can you please > s/max_vcpu_ids/max_vcpu_id/g > > At least to be "max_vcpu_ids" has some of the same confusion as the > existing code - it reads like the maximum *number* of IDs, rather than > the maximum *value* of IDs. > Well... this is precisely the point. Finding a suitable name for something that is essentially the "size of a range of consecutive IDs starting from 0" and not the "maximum value of IDs". Not sure of the more appropriate wording to describe this is a _least upper bound_ actually. > > --- > > include/hw/ppc/spapr.h | 2 +- > > include/hw/ppc/spapr_irq.h | 8 ++++---- > > include/hw/ppc/spapr_xive.h | 2 +- > > include/hw/ppc/xics_spapr.h | 2 +- > > hw/intc/spapr_xive.c | 8 ++++---- > > hw/intc/spapr_xive_kvm.c | 4 ++-- > > hw/intc/xics_kvm.c | 4 ++-- > > hw/intc/xics_spapr.c | 8 ++++---- > > hw/ppc/spapr.c | 8 ++++---- > > hw/ppc/spapr_irq.c | 18 +++++++++--------- > > 10 files changed, 32 insertions(+), 32 deletions(-) > > > > diff --git a/include/hw/ppc/spapr.h b/include/hw/ppc/spapr.h > > index b7ced9faebf5..dc99d45e2852 100644 > > --- a/include/hw/ppc/spapr.h > > +++ b/include/hw/ppc/spapr.h > > @@ -849,7 +849,7 @@ int spapr_hpt_shift_for_ramsize(uint64_t ramsize);
